On my Tam Coc – Mua Cave Tour, you’ll get to see the stunning beauty of Tam Coc, often called “Ha Long Bay on land,” with its peaceful boat rides and breathtaking scenery. Then, we’ll head to Mua Cave, known as the “miniature Great Wall of Vietnam.” I’ll guide you up the hike to the top, where you’ll be rewarded with panoramic views of Tam Coc and Ninh Binh city that are totally worth the climb. You’ll enjoy a fun day filled with boating, hiking, and cycling through Vietnam’s beautiful countryside. We’ll bike through quiet villages, paddle past towering limestone cliffs, and explore some surprising and quirky caves along the way. If you love a bit of adventure and want to experience the real charm of the countryside, this tour is perfect for you!
8:00 – 8:30 I’ll pick you up from your hotel and set off for Ninh Binh province. 10:30 Arrive at Mua Cave, known as the “miniature Great Wall of Vietnam.” We’ll hike up to the top for stunning panoramic views of the Tam Coc valley and Ninh Binh city — a sight you won’t forget. 11:30 After the hike, we’ll head to a local restaurant where you can enjoy a tasty Vietnamese lunch. 1:00 PM Next, we’ll take a traditional boat ride along the peaceful Ngo Dong River in Tam Coc, passing through three beautiful caves: Hang Ca, Hang Hai, and Hang Ba. 3:30 If you love cycling, join the optional 40-minute bike ride through quiet village paths to Bich Dong Pagoda and back (about 5 km round trip). It’s a relaxing way to enjoy the countryside, rice fields, and local life. 6:00 PM We’ll return to Hanoi and drop you off at your hotel, ending the day’s adventure.
